    From Fan Chengda's "Four Seasons Pastoral Miscellaneous: Its Forty-Four" in the Song Dynasty

    The mud of the new construction field is flat with a noisy mirror, and every family beats rice while the frost is sunny.

    There was a light thunder in the laughter and singing, and the flail sounded until dawn all night.

    Translations. The ground of the newly built yard is flat like a mirror, and every household takes advantage of the frost to harvest rice on a sunny day.

    The peasants laughed and sang, and the sound in the yard was like light thunder, and the peasants waved their flails to beat the rice all night long, and the sound lasted until dawn.

    Exegesis. Frost clear: refers to a sunny day after frost.

    Flail: It is composed of a long handle and a group of flat rows of bamboo or wooden strips, which is used to beat grains, wheat, beans, sesame seeds, etc., so that the grains fall off.

    In the Song Dynasty, Fan Chengda was a four-hour pastoral miscellaneous.

    The Four Seasons Pastoral Miscellaneous is a group of large-scale Tianjia poems written by him after retiring to his hometown, which is divided into five parts: spring, late spring, summer, autumn and winter, with twelve poems in each part, a total of 60 poems. The poem describes the scenery of the four seasons of spring, summer, autumn and winter in the countryside and the life of the peasants, and also reflects the exploitation and hardship of the peasants.

    This part probably refers to the scene of threshing the grain after the autumn harvest, that is, the rice grains are beaten out of it, expressing the author's joy of harvest and praise for labor.
